Frequently Asked Questions
What is the ICD-10 code for chondromalacia, joints of left hand?
The ICD-10-CM code for chondromalacia, joints of left hand is M94.242. The full clinical description is "Chondromalacia, joints of left hand". M94.242 is a billable/specific code that can be used on insurance claims and medical billing.
What does ICD-10 code M94.242 mean?
ICD-10-CM code M94.242 represents "Chondromalacia, joints of left hand". It is classified under Chapter 13: Diseases of the Musculoskeletal System and Connective Tissue and is a billable/specific code that can be used on a claim.
Is M94.242 a billable code?
Yes, M94.242 is a billable/specific ICD-10-CM code and can be used to indicate a diagnosis on a medical claim.
What chapter is M94.242 in?
M94.242 is in Chapter 13: Diseases of the Musculoskeletal System and Connective Tissue (codes M00-M99).
What codes cannot be used with M94.242?
M94.242 has Excludes1 notes indicating codes that cannot be used together with it, including: postprocedural chondropathies (M96.-); chondromalacia patellae (M22.4).
